Sex & Nudity

  • A mobster and his wife are shown fully clothed in bed when Seven up cops Buddy and Mingo appear in their bedroom wanting information from the mobster about Ansel's murderer.

Violence & Gore

  • During one scene Buddy and his partner downright grill the husband of a couple, sleeping in bed. The man has a connection to the mob. Not pleasant. Fairly brutal. Buddy destroys their vase.
  • Some, including a man shot in a car's trunk, a high speed chase between mobsters and police shooting it out on a highway and, later, in a junkyard, a suspect is slapped while interrogated.

Profanity

  • 4 uses of 'Jesus' 4 uses of 'Jesus Christ' and 2 uses of "For Christ's sake". 8 uses of 'Shit' 3 uses of 'Son of a bitch' and 2 uses of 'Bastard'. 5 uses of 'Goddamn' and 2 uses of "For God's sake". Occasional uses of 'Hell' 'Damn' and 'Ass'
  • Buddy, or another driver, says "F--k off." It probably can be heard, because the "closed captions" show it being said. Possibly one other F-word.
  • The violence and cursing is intense, but never graphic. Being pre-PG-13, when some movies were a little less rougher and helicopter moms weren't as common, you'll find some objectionable things in a PG movie way more back then. Nothing too graphic.
  • Cinemax content advisory: rated PG for violence (V), adult language (AL), and adult content (AC).

Alcohol, Drugs & Smoking

  • Some smoking, e.g. Buddy and Mingo are shown with cigarettes and cigars as well as smoking by the mobsters.

Frightening & Intense Scenes

  • A very intense movie. Lots of action violence, a chase sequence going from Midtown Manhattan to the Palisades, plotting. Not a family movie.
